Hi,

I am working on android for omap zoom2 target.
omapkernel - 2.6.27
android    - RLS25.6


When try to do Audio play back from Android UI on zoom2 board,
WAV & AMR-NB - default PV software codecs are selected and playback
is
fine.
MP3          - Hardware codec has been chosen by PV player, player
does not come up and playback is not happening.


Enabled PV & OMX logs and collected logs while playing MP3 clip.
>From logs found that LCML Codec/DSP Bridge Initialization is failing.


Can someone help me in enabling Hardware Codecs.


Below are the logs collected while playing MP3,


E/PV      (  779): PVLOG:TID
(0x1375e8):Time=205:PVMFOMXAudioDecNode::DoPrepare(): There are 2
components of role audio_decoder.mp3
E/OMX_MP3 (  779): Entering OMX_ComponentInit
E/PV      (  779): PVLOG:TID
(0x1375e8):Time=208:PVMFOMXAudioDecNode::DoPrepare(): Got Component
OMX.TI.MP3.decode handle
E/PV      (  779): PVLOG:TID
(0x1375e8):Time=209:PVMFOMXAudioDecNode::NegotiateComponentParameters
() In
E/PV      (  779): PVLOG:TID
(0x1375e8):Time=209:PVMFOMXAudioDecNode::NegotiateComponentParameters
() Calling audio config parser - TrackConfig = 0x11b448,
TrackConfigSize = 8, mimetype = audio/MPEG
E/PV      (  779): PVLOG:TID
(0x1375e8):Time=209:PVMFOMXAudioDecNode::NegotiateComponentParameters
() Found Input port index 0
E/PV      (  779): PVLOG:TID
(0x1375e8):Time=209:PVMFOMXAudioDecNode::NegotiateComponentParameters
() Found Output port index 1
E/PV      (  779): PVLOG:TID
(0x1375e8):Time=209:PVMFOMXAudioDecNode::NegotiateComponentParameters
() Inport buffers 4,size 8000
E/PV      (  779): PVLOG:TID
(0x1375e8):Time=209:PVMFOMXAudioDecNode::NegotiateComponentParameters
() Outport buffers 4,size 81920
E/PV      (  779): PVLOG:TID
(0x1375e8):Time=210:PVMFOMXAudioDecNode::DoPrepare(): Changing
Component state Loaded -> Idle
E/PV      (  779): PVLOG:TID
(0x1375e8):Time=213:PVMFOMXAudioDecNode::CreateInputMemPool() start
E/PV      (  779): PVLOG:TID
(0x1375e8):Time=213:PVMFOMXAudioDecNode::CreateInputMemPool()
allocating buffer header pointers and shared media data ptrs
E/PV      (  779): PVLOG:TID
(0x1375e8):Time=213:PVMFOMXAudioDecNode::CreateInputMemPool() done
E/PV      (  779): PVLOG:TID
(0x1375e8):Time=213:PVMFOMXAudioDecNode::ProvideBuffersToComponent()
enter
E/PV      (  779): PVLOG:TID
(0x1375e8):Time=213:PVMFOMXAudioDecNode::ProvideBuffersToComponent()
done
E/PV      (  779): PVLOG:TID
(0x1375e8):Time=213:PVMFOMXAudioDecNode::CreateOutMemPool() start
E/PV      (  779): PVLOG:TID
(0x1375e8):Time=213:PVMFOMXAudioDecNode::CreateOutMemPool()
Allocating
output buffer header pointers
E/PV      (  779): PVLOG:TID
(0x1375e8):Time=213:PVMFOMXAudioDecNode::CreateOutMemPool()
Allocating
output buffers of size 81920 as well
E/PV      (  779): PVLOG:TID
(0x1375e8):Time=213:PVMFOMXAudioDecNode::CreateOutMemPool() done
E/PV      (  779): PVLOG:TID
(0x1375e8):Time=213:PVMFOMXAudioDecNode::ProvideBuffersToComponent()
enter
E/OMX_MP3 (  779): 768 :: Error : InitMMCodec failed...>>>>>>
E/PV      (  779): PVLOG:TID
(0x1375e8):Time=217:PVMFOMXAudioDecNode::ProvideBuffersToComponent()
done
E/PV      (  779): PVLOG:TID
(0x1375e8):Time=217:PVMediaOutputNode::RequestCompleted: Cmd ID=5
E/PV      (  779): PVLOG:TID
(0x1375e8):Time=217:PVMediaOutputNode:CommandComplete Id 8 Cmd 5
Status 1 Context 0 EVData 0 EVCode 0
E/PV      (  779): PVLOG:TID
(0x1375e8):Time=217:PVMediaOutputNode:SetState 3


Thanks,
Sunee

--~--~---------~--~----~------------~-------~--~----~
unsubscribe: android-porting+unsubscr...@googlegroups.com
website: http://groups.google.com/group/android-porting
-~----------~----~----~----~------~----~------~--~---

Reply via email to